Output dcfb53f3f1863c65d35d0e18a1aafcbf30367a91cf74e959040139cd838a1137:21

value
1009000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 895ada7cfb4a3425eac33e983ba5f5634a341b2b21e9fcd7d18e344f52bf0b5a
address
bc1p39dd5l8mfg6zt6kr86vrhf04vd9rgxety85le4733c6y754lpddqh09jee
transaction
dcfb53f3f1863c65d35d0e18a1aafcbf30367a91cf74e959040139cd838a1137
spent
true